Northwood University hosts several notable events that contribute to its campus culture and community engagement. The Auto Show/Homecoming event combines a celebration of the automotive industry with traditional homecoming festivities, offering students a unique occasion to connect and participate in campus spirit activities.
The university also organizes Values Emphasis Week, a dedicated period focused on fostering reflection and discussion around core principles that guide personal and academic growth. This event encourages students to engage with ethical and leadership themes relevant to their development.
Go MAD Day is another tradition at Northwood University, designed to promote enthusiasm and school pride through various activities. It serves as a vibrant expression of community identity and student involvement.
Northwood University offers college-owned housing that accommodates just over half of its student body, with 53% of students living on campus. The residential facilities provide co-educational housing arrangements, allowing male and female students to live in the same community. For those who prefer to live off campus, 47% of the student population commutes to the university.
Freshmen at Northwood University are permitted to have parking privileges, facilitating easy access to campus for those who bring vehicles. Additionally, high-speed internet is available on campus, supporting the academic and personal connectivity needs of students.
